This seventeen chapter, brand new text presents a multi-perspective approach to Knowledge Management. It spans electrical engineering, artificial intelligence, information systems, and business. Comprehensive yet clearly and concisely written, Knowledge Management is simultaneously strong in managerial, technical, and systemic aspects of Knowledge Management, providing students with the right combination of theory, technology, and solutions.
